  On February 12, on the 54th day of Wei Ya's "disappearance", a live broadcast room called "Bee Surprise Club" was quietly launched.

As of March 1, its number of followers was 1.89 million.

  This seemingly "brand new" live broadcast room is full of the shadow of "Viya".

Among the 6 anchors, 5 are assistant broadcasters and models in the live broadcast room of Wei Ya. The name of the Bee Surprise Club is also similar to Wei Ya's public account "Weiya Surprise Club". Even the background picture of the live broadcast room is also similar to that of Wei Ya. Wei Ya's live room is the same night view of the city.

All kinds of details can't help but cause people's speculation: "Weiya is back?"

  The Red Star Capital Bureau noticed that the company certified by the live broadcast room of Bee Surprise Club has no business information connection with Wei Ya, but the registered address of the company of Wei Ya’s husband Dong Haifeng is registered with the company Baifeng Culture, a company certified by the live broadcast room of Bee Surprise Club. The address is also in Jiangjin International Building, Binjiang District, Hangzhou City, separated by 5 floors.

  Does the Bee Surprise Club have anything to do with Wei Ya?

Is Wei Ya coming back with a "shell change"?

Bee Surprise Club and Qianxun are "unanimously silent".

  In an interview with the Red Star Capital Bureau, lawyer Hu Gang, deputy secretary-general of the Legal Affairs Committee of the Internet Society of China and lawyer of the China Consumers Association, said that the tax department had previously imposed a tax on Wei Ya’s tax evasion, which limited tax-related companies. The company behind it is not within the scope of Weiya's tax-related subject company, so their actions are not related and belong to separate legal subjects.

  Hu Gang further pointed out that for the public's doubts, the company belonging to the Bee Surprise Club should actively and comprehensively disclose whether it is related to Weiya. This is their obligation as a live broadcaster, and the platform should also urge their companies to take the initiative to disclose.

  Liu Chenxing (pseudonym) used to be a frequent visitor to Weiya's live broadcast room. She told the Red Star Capital Bureau that the earliest news of the launch of "Bee Surprise Club" was when a group friend reposted the live broadcast link in Weiya's fan group.

  Liu Chenxing entered the live broadcast room with the link, and saw 5 familiar anchors shouting in unison: "We're here", "Let's not talk nonsense, let's draw prizes first", which felt familiar to Wei Ya's live broadcast room.

She clicked "Follow the Live Room" and joined the fan group of the Bee Surprise Club, and found that there were many "old fans" of Wei Ya in the new fan group.

  On the day the Bee Surprise Club was launched, it accumulated 1.15 million views and gained 102,000 fans.

On the second day, the cumulative number of views exceeded 3 million; on the third day, 4.4 million; on the fourth day, 5.5 million; on the fifth day, the cumulative number of views reached the level of 10 million.

According to the preliminary statistics of the Red Star Capital Bureau, since the beginning of the broadcast, 14 of the 17 live broadcasts of the Bee Surprise Club have accumulated more than 5 million views, and 3 have exceeded 10 million.

In addition, Bee Surprise Club also maintains the frequency of "daily broadcast", with an average of 50-70 products on each live broadcast, and the number of fans has soared to 1.89 million.

  A Taobao insider told the Red Star Capital Bureau: "For the new team, this achievement is very rare."

  Hangzhou Baifeng Culture Media Co., Ltd. (hereinafter referred to as "Baifeng Culture") is a company certified by the live broadcast room of Bee Surprise Club.

The Red Star Capital Bureau found that the company, which was established in August 2021, is not related to Wei Ya and others from the industrial and commercial registration information.

Its legal representative, He Weihua, has only two companies under his name, and no information about him and Wei Ya can be found.

  However, the Red Star Capital Bureau found that the registered addresses of Hangzhou Lanhai Enterprise Management Consulting Company and Hangzhou Fenghan Enterprise Management Co., Ltd. under Wei Ya’s husband Dong Haifeng are the same as the registered address of Baifeng Culture in Jiangjin International Building, Binjiang District, Hangzhou City. , only 5 floors apart.

  According to the Financial Associated Press, Wei Ya’s Qianxun side has not responded to her relationship with the Bee Surprise Club, but many Qianxun staff members have promoted the Bee Surprise Club related information.

In addition, the Red Star Capital Bureau found that many Weibo accounts that released Taobao live broadcast notices posted the Bee Surprise Club together with Li Jiaqi’s live broadcast notice.

  Is the launch of "Bee Surprise Club" a preview of Wei Ya's return, or Qianxun Company, while Wei Ya's popularity has not yet dissipated, reorganized the live broadcast room with the appeal of Wei Ya's help to broadcast, and revitalized Wei Ya's traffic again. It is yet to be confirmed.

  On February 28, Cui Lili, director of the E-Commerce Research Institute, told the Red Star Capital Bureau: "To a certain extent, Wei Ya still has a certain amount of die-hard fans. If everyone knows that she is impossible to come back, they may also This trust, as well as product selection standards, attributes, etc., are transferred to the resources of their institutions (or new anchors).”

  Cui Lili believes that the emergence of the Bee Surprise Club is more like an attempt and a verification of a new mode of operation.

"I think the broadcast assistant should be a model that has been practiced before. Whether it is Lao Luo's assistant or some attempts similar to the Simba family, in fact, the assistant is the most familiar to the audience other than the anchor. It doesn't seem like there's any better way to do it than to let the broadcaster lead the charge."

  But Cui Lili also said: "In the past, it was difficult for Wei Ya's traffic to be transplanted to a newcomer in a short period of time." The data shows that before being blocked, Wei Ya's live broadcast room already had 92.27 million fans, 45 times that of the Bee Surprise Club. many.

  For Bee Surprise Club, it is not easy to undertake Weiya fan traffic.

In the past, Wei Ya relied on the voice of the super-head anchor, and many products could get the lowest price, attracting fans to buy, but the new broadcast assistant team obviously could not replicate this.
